Farmington, AR, nestled in the heart of Northwest Arkansas, experiences a dynamic climate that places unique demands on its HVAC systems and, by extension, its ductwork. With hot, humid summers that can push indoor humidity levels high, and crisp, often dry winters, the integrity and efficiency of your duct installation are paramount. High humidity can lead to condensation within ductwork, fostering mold and mildew growth, which then circulates throughout your home. Conversely, dry winter air can exacerbate respiratory issues and make your heating system work overtime. D&D Air Duct Cleaning understands these local challenges intimately. Whether you’re in a growing neighborhood like Green Hills or a more established area, a professionally installed duct system is the backbone of comfortable, healthy indoor air quality. Proper duct installation ensures that conditioned air is delivered efficiently to every room, preventing hot or cold spots and reducing the strain on your HVAC unit, ultimately saving you money on energy bills and prolonging the life of your equipment. With proper installation and occasional maintenance from D&D Air Duct Cleaning, professionally installed ductwork can last for 20-25 years or even longer. The longevity is influenced by the quality of materials used and how well it’s protected from the specific environmental factors common in Farmington, such as high humidity that can accelerate wear if not properly managed.
How does Farmington’s humid climate affect the need for specific duct installation materials?
Farmington’s high summer humidity necessitates ductwork that is resistant to moisture. We often recommend materials with superior insulation and vapor barriers to prevent condensation from forming inside the ducts. This is crucial for inhibiting mold and mildew growth, which thrive in damp conditions and can significantly impact indoor air quality throughout your Farmington home.

Can proper duct installation help with allergies and asthma in Farmington, AR?
Absolutely. A well-installed duct system by D&D Air Duct Cleaning is designed for optimal airflow and minimal leakage. This means fewer points for dust, pollen, pet dander, and other allergens to enter the system and circulate throughout your Farmington home. Proper sealing and design contribute significantly to a healthier indoor environment for allergy and asthma sufferers.
What is the difference between flexible and rigid ductwork, and which is best for Farmington homes?
Rigid ductwork (typically metal) is more durable, offers better airflow, and is less prone to leaks and punctures, making it ideal for main supply lines. Flexible ductwork is easier to maneuver in tight spaces but can be more susceptible to kinks and tears, potentially reducing airflow. The best choice for your Farmington home depends on the specific application and location within your HVAC system; our experts at D&D Air Duct Cleaning will recommend the most suitable type for each section.
